Mesothelioma Lawyers

Mesothelioma lawyers specialize in asbestos litigation, which includes trust fund claims and lawsuits. To be able to successfully handle these claims, they need to be aware of the complex state laws and national legal requirements.

They should also have access to asbestos databases of contaminated jobsites and identify asbestos-related companies that could be responsible for the exposure. A qualified asbestos lawyer can make the process of filing a lawsuit simple so that the victims can concentrate on treatment and being with their loved family members.

The first step to filing an asbestos lawsuit is to meet with a mesothelioma lawyer for a free case evaluation. Your lawyer will assist you in determining the companies responsible for your case and which type of claim is most appropriate. Asbestos exposure can take many forms and it is difficult for asbestos-related victims to recall precisely when or where they were exposed. However, mesothelioma lawyers have access to databases that list thousands of businesses as well as products and job places where asbestos exposure has occurred.

Asbestos attorneys are also aware of how they can investigate the case to discover evidence to support your claim. For instance, you could have medical records that confirm your mesothelioma diagnosis or the death certificate of your loved one that mentions "mesothelioma" as the reason for your death of a loved one. asbestos legal lawyers are well-versed in the process of ordering these documents and know the questions to ask for to get the most info from them.

Additionally, an experienced mesothelioma lawyer will be aware of how state laws impact the how you file your case. For instance the law in New York requires that you file your lawsuit in-state if the company responsible for your asbestos exposure comes from the state. Lawyers from national firms have experience in filing claims in different states and are familiar with the laws in each jurisdiction.

Mesothelioma is a life-threatening and painful disease, affects the lung linings. It is caused by exposure to asbestos which was used in a range of residential and commercial construction products for more than 30 years. The exposure could be experienced in a variety of ways, including at work or in schools, as well as in the military, and at home.

A person who has been diagnosed with mesothelioma can file a lawsuit for personal injury against the company who exposed them to asbestos. They may also file a lawsuit for the wrongful death of loved ones who have passed away from mesothelioma and other asbestos-related diseases.

Asbestos victims can seek financial compensation for expenses like medical bills, lost wages and the cost of treatment. Asbestos lawyers can help their clients recover damages through mesothelioma lawsuits or trust fund claims against companies responsible for their asbestos exposure. They can also assist their clients in filing a wrongful death lawsuit on behalf of a loved one who has died from mesothelioma.

A mesothelioma attorney can help determine if the patient has an appropriate claim and assist the patient make a claim, VA claim or trust fund. The value of each mesothelioma claim is different and determined by multiple factors that include the patient's asbestos exposure, age at diagnosis, as well as the amount they've lost due to the disease. Compensation may include future and past medical expenses as well as lost wages, the loss of a loved one and legal costs, punitive damages and suffering and pain.
